CRIME BLOTTER
Police reports from local municipalities
UNIVERSITY PARK AREA
A thief stole $10 after cutting the convertible top and damaging the steering column on a 1994 Ford Mustang in the 12300 block of Southwest 26th Street between 11 p.m. Sept. 23 and 2:30 a.m. Sept. 24. Damage was estimated at $400.
A laptop computer and a camera were taken from a 2008 Volvo in the 1100 block of Southwest 107th Avenue between 2:45 and 4 p.m. Sept. 15. The items were valued at $2,200.
OLYMPIA HEIGHTS
A vandal broke a window on a 2001 Toyota Corolla in the 3600 block of Southwest 109th Court between
4 and 8:45 p.m. Sept. 25. Damage was estimated at $150.
Someone stole a saw, an air compressor, a drill and a hat after breaking a door lock on a 2005 Chevrolet Express van in the 11300 block of Southwest 40th Street at 1:15 p.m. Sept. 24. The items were valued at $1,550. Damage was estimated at $100.
FLAGAMI AREA
A briefcase, a purse and identification cards were stolen from a 2002 Jeep Cherokee in the 7700 block of West Flagler Street between 3:45 and 4 p.m.
Sept. 23. The items were valued at $701.
A thief stole a radio after damaging a door lock on a 2002 Chevrolet Tahoe in the 7700 block of West Flagler Street between 8:30 a.m. and 3 p.m. Sept. 24. The radio was valued at $500. Damage was estimated at $200.
Two weed trimmers, a lawn mower, two edgers, a trimmer and other items were stolen from a 1988 Well trailer attached to a 1999 Chevrolet Express van in the 1700 block of Southwest 73rd Avenue between noon and 3:50 p.m. Sept. 15. The items were valued at $3,874.
Someone stole a bag and makeup after breaking a window on a 2006 Subaru in the 7900 block of Southwest 19th Street at 7:45 p.m.
Sept. 26. The items were valued at $110. Damage was estimated at $300.
SCHENLEY PARK AREA
A thief stole a briefcase from a 2005 Chrysler in the 3700 block of Southwest 62nd Avenue between 1 and 7 a.m. Sept. 24. The briefcase was valued at $50. Damage was estimated at $300.
SOUTH MIAMI
Two men shoplifted seven shirts valued at $600 from Armani Exchange, 5701 SW 72nd St., at 3:30 p.m. Sept. 17.
PINECREST
A thief stole $500 from a woman's bank account at Washington Mutual, 10301 S. Dixie Hwy., between 3 and
9 p.m. Sept. 20. The money was stolen using an ATM card that the woman had forgotten to collect.
Someone smashed a window on a 2002 Chevrolet Suburban in the 6300 block of Southwest 120th Street and stole a camera and a GPS together valued at $1,200 at 11:30 p.m. Sept. 20.
FAIRWAY HEIGHTS
Fifty dollars were stolen after someone broke a window on a 2000 Chevrolet pickup in the 11000 block of Southwest 166th Terrace between midnight and
7:30 a.m. Sept. 11. Damage was estimated at $400.
A thief searched a 2005 Lexus in the 11300 block of Southwest 156th Street after breaking a window between 8 p.m. Sept. 19 and 10:45 a.m. Sept. 20. Damage was estimated at $300.
WEST PERRINE
A thief took $70, six CDs and a flashlight from a 2003 Chevrolet Avalanche in the 10900 block of Southwest 179th Street between 7 p.m. Sept. 26 and 10:10 a.m.
Sept. 27. The items were valued at $220.
CUTLER RIDGE
A radio was stolen from a 1997 GMC box truck in the 10700 block of Southwest 190th Street after damaging a door lock and the dash at 2:45 p.m. Sept. 20. The radio was valued at $300. Damage was estimated at $1,050.
